The Benefits of Citrus for Your Skin

Citrus fruits like lemons, oranges, grapefruits, and limes are not just delicious; they offer a wealth of skincare benefits due to their high vitamin C content, antioxidants, and natural exfoliating properties. Here are some of the key benefits:

1. Brightening Effects

Vitamin C, a powerful antioxidant found in abundance in citrus fruits, is known for its skin-brightening properties. It helps to reduce the appearance of dark spots, hyperpigmentation, and uneven skin tone, leaving your skin looking fresh and radiant.

2. Natural Exfoliant

Citrus peels contain natural acids like citric acid that can help exfoliate the skin gently. This makes them an excellent ingredient in body scrubs, as they help remove dead skin cells and promote cell turnover.

3. Hydration Boost

Many citrus fruits have a high water content which aids in hydrating the skin. When used in scrubs, they can help keep your skin moisturized while exfoliating it.

4. Antimicrobial Properties

Citrus fruits have antimicrobial properties that can help combat acne-causing bacteria on the skin’s surface, making them suitable for oily or acne-prone skin.

5. Aromatherapy Benefits

The uplifting scent of citrus can enhance your mood and provide a sense of relaxation during your skincare routine. It’s a little self-care moment that goes beyond physical benefits.

Essential Ingredients for DIY Citrus Body Scrubs

Before diving into our favorite recipes, it’s essential to understand the primary ingredients that will form the base of your body scrub:

  • Sugar or Salt: Acts as an exfoliant to slough away dead skin cells. Sugar is gentler on the skin compared to salt.
  • Carrier Oils: Such as coconut oil, olive oil, or almond oil to moisturize your skin after exfoliation.
  • Citrus Juice or Zest: Provides brightening effects and adds a refreshing scent.
  • Essential Oils (optional): For added fragrance and therapeutic benefits.

Citrus Body Scrub Recipes

Here are three easy-to-make DIY citrus-inspired body scrubs that will leave your skin feeling rejuvenated and radiant.

Recipe 1: Lemon Sugar Scrub

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/2 cup coconut oil (melted)
  • Zest of 1 lemon
  • Juice of 1 lemon
  • Optional: A few drops of lemon essential oil

Instructions:

  1. In a bowl, combine the sugar and melted coconut oil until well mixed.
  2. Add the lemon zest and juice to the mixture.
  3. If desired, add a few drops of lemon essential oil for an extra citrusy aroma.
  4. Mix until everything is combined.
  5. Transfer the scrub to an airtight jar for storage.

Usage:

Use this scrub in the shower on damp skin. Gently massage it into your body using circular motions for about five minutes before rinsing off with warm water.

Recipe 2: Orange Coffee Scrub

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up ground coffee (used or fresh)
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ar
  • 1/2 cup olive oil
  • Zest of 1 orange
  • Juice of 1 orange
  • Optional: A few drops of sweet orange essential oil

Instructions:

  1. In a bowl, combine the ground coffee and brown sugar.
  2. Stir in the olive oil until fully incorporated.
  3. Add the orange zest and juice to the mixture.
  4. If desired, add sweet orange essential oil for added fragrance.
  5. Mix thoroughly until you achieve a consistent texture.

Usage:

Apply this energizing scrub in the shower, focusing on areas like legs and arms where you may want extra exfoliation. Rinse off thoroughly to reveal smoother and more radiant skin.

Recipe 3: Grapefruit Salt Scrub

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up sea salt (or Epsom salt)
  • 1/2 cup almond oil (or any carrier oil)
  • Zest of 1 grapefruit
  • Juice of 1 grapefruit
  • Optional: A few drops of grapefruit essential oil

Instructions:

  1. In a mixing bowl, combine sea salt with almond oil until well blended.
  2. Add grapefruit zest and juice to the mixture.
  3. Enhance with grapefruit essential oil if you desire a stronger scent.
  4. Mix all ingredients thoroughly.

Usage:

This salt scrub is perfect for rough areas like elbows and knees. Massage it onto damp skin before rinsing it off with warm water for smooth results.

Tips for an Effective Scrubbing Experience

To maximize effectiveness and enjoyment when using your DIY citrus scrubs, consider these tips:

Choose Fresh Ingredients

Whenever possible, opt for fresh citrus fruits instead of bottled juices or dried zest for maximum nutrient benefits.

Test Before You Apply

If you’re trying out a new scrub recipe or have sensitive skin, always perform a patch test before applying it over a larger area to avoid irritation or allergic reactions.

Store Properly

Keep your scrubs in airtight containers in a cool place to maintain freshness—avoid direct sunlight which may degrade their quality over time.

Use Regularly but Sparingly

Aim to use your body scrub once or twice a week. Over-exfoliating can irritate your skin rather than benefit it.
